A data analyst is a professional who collects, organizes, and interprets data to help businesses make informed decisions. They examine large datasets to identify trends, patterns, and insights that can improve business performance, solve operational challenges, and support strategic planning.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Data analysts work with structured data from various sources and present their findings through reports, dashboards, and visualizations. They use statistical techniques, data visualization tools, and programming languages to transform raw data into meaningful business insights that support data-driven decision-making. Data analysts can work in industries such as finance, healthcare, retail, information technology, e-commerce, manufacturing, and marketing.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large desktop-image\"><a href=\"https:\/\/internshala.com\/?utm_source=is_blog&amp;utm_medium=data-analyst-vs-data-scientist-complete-guide&amp;utm_campaign=candidate-web-banner\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"203\" src=\"https:\/\/internshala.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/10\/Find-and-apply-web-1024x203.jpg\" alt=\"Find and apply web banner\" class=\"wp-image-25333\" srcset=\"https:\/\/internshala.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/10\/Find-and-apply-web-1024x203.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/internshala.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/10\/Find-and-apply-web-672x133.jpg 672w, https:\/\/internshala.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/10\/Find-and-apply-web-1536x305.jpg 1536w, https:\/\/internshala.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/10\/Find-and-apply-web-2048x406.jpg 2048w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><\/a><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-full mobile-image\"><a href=\"https:\/\/internshala.com\/?utm_source=is_blog&amp;utm_medium=data-analyst-vs-data-scientist-complete-guide&amp;utm_campaign=candidate-mobile-banner\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"356\" height=\"256\" src=\"https:\/\/internshala.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/10\/Find-and-apply-mobile-1.jpg\" alt=\"Find and apply mobile banner\" class=\"wp-image-25334\"\/><\/a><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>i. A <a href=\"https:\/\/internshala.com\/blog\/data-analyst-resume-samples-and-templates\/?utm_source=is_blog&amp;utm_medium=data-analyst-vs-data-scientist-complete-guide&amp;utm_campaign=candidate-blog-detail\">data analyst resume<\/a> should highlight the following essential skills: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ul>\n<li>Data analysis and statistical techniques<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>SQL for querying and managing databases<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Microsoft Excel for data cleaning, analysis, and reporting<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><a href=\"https:\/\/trainings.internshala.com\/blog\/what-is-python\/?utm_source=is_blog&amp;utm_medium=data-analyst-vs-data-scientist-complete-guide&amp;utm_campaign=candidate-blog-detail\">Python<\/a> or R for data analysis and automation<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Data visualization using tools such as Power BI, Tableau, or Looker Studio<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Knowledge of databases and data warehousing concepts<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Critical thinking and problem-solving abilities<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Strong communication and presentation skills<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Attention to detail and data accuracy<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Business acumen to interpret data and provide actionable insights<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Pro Tip: <\/strong>Explore our beginner\u2019s guide on \u2018<a href=\"https:\/\/internshala.com\/blog\/how-to-become-a-data-analyst-in-india\/?utm_source=is_blog&amp;utm_medium=data-analyst-vs-data-scientist-complete-guide&amp;utm_campaign=candidate-blog-detail\">How to become a data analyst?<\/a>\u2019 and learn more about the career path.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Who_Is_a_Data_Scientist\"><\/span><strong>Who Is a Data Scientist?<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>A data scientist is a professional who collects, processes, and analyzes large volumes of structured and unstructured data to solve complex business problems and predict future outcomes. Unlike data analysts, who primarily focus on interpreting historical data, data scientists use advanced statistical methods, <a href=\"https:\/\/trainings.internshala.com\/blog\/what-is-machine-learning\/?utm_source=is_blog&amp;utm_medium=data-analyst-vs-data-scientist-complete-guide&amp;utm_campaign=candidate-blog-detail\">machine learning<\/a>, and <a href=\"https:\/\/trainings.internshala.com\/blog\/what-is-artificial-intelligence\/?utm_source=is_blog&amp;utm_medium=data-analyst-vs-data-scientist-complete-guide&amp;utm_campaign=candidate-blog-detail\">artificial intelligence<\/a> to build predictive models and generate actionable insights.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Data scientists work with large datasets, develop algorithms, and create data-driven solutions that help organizations improve decision-making, automate processes, and identify new business opportunities. They are employed across industries such as finance, healthcare, e-commerce, information technology, manufacturing, telecommunications, and retail, where data plays a key role in driving business growth and innovation.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-table is-style-stripes\"><table><tbody><tr><td><strong>You know?<\/strong> According to the India Brand Equity Foundation, employment in data science and mathematical sciences is expected to grow by 31.4% by 2030, driven largely by rapid advancements in artificial intelligence.<\/td><\/tr><\/tbody><\/table><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>i. Technical Skills Required: Data Analyst vs. Data Scientist<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Although both data analysts and data scientists work with data, the technical skills required for each role differ based on their responsibilities. Data analysts focus on collecting, cleaning, analyzing, and visualizing data to support business decisions. Data scientists require advanced programming, statistics, and machine learning expertise to build predictive models and solve complex business problems.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The table below compares the key technical skills of data analyst vs. data scientist required for both careers.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-table\"><table><tbody><tr><td><strong>Aspect<\/strong><\/td><td><strong>Data Analyst<\/strong><\/td><td><strong>Data Scientist<\/strong><\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Primary Focus<\/strong><\/td><td>Data analysis, reporting, and business insights<\/td><td>Predictive analytics, machine learning, and AI<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Programming Skills<\/strong><\/td><td>Basic to intermediate Python, R, and SQL<\/td><td>Advanced Python, R, SQL, <a href=\"https:\/\/trainings.internshala.com\/blog\/what-is-java\/?utm_source=is_blog&amp;utm_medium=data-analyst-vs-data-scientist-complete-guide&amp;utm_campaign=candidate-blog-detail\">Java<\/a>, or Scala<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>SQL<\/strong><\/td><td>Required for querying and managing databases<\/td><td>Required for querying, managing, and processing large datasets<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Excel<\/strong><\/td><td>Frequently used for analysis and reporting<\/td><td>Used occasionally for basic analysis<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Statistics<\/strong><\/td><td>Descriptive and inferential statistics<\/td><td>Advanced statistics, probability, and mathematical modeling<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Machine Learning<\/strong><\/td><td>Basic knowledge is beneficial but often optional<\/td><td>Core skill required for building predictive models<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Data Visualization<\/strong><\/td><td><a href=\"https:\/\/trainings.internshala.com\/blog\/what-is-power-bi\/\">Power BI<\/a>, Tableau, Looker Studio, Excel<\/td><td>Tableau, Power BI, Matplotlib, Seaborn, Plotly<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Big Data Technologies<\/strong><\/td><td>Basic familiarity with Hadoop or Spark is helpful<\/td><td>Hands-on experience with Hadoop, Spark, or similar frameworks<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Cloud Platforms<\/strong><\/td><td>Basic knowledge of A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ud is an advantage<\/td><td>Practical experience with A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ud is often required<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Business Intelligence<\/strong><\/td><td>Strong understanding of KPIs, dashboards, and reporting<\/td><td>Focus on predictive insights and data-driven business solutions<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Problem-Solving<\/strong><\/td><td>Identifies trends and supports business decisions<\/td><td>Solves complex business problems using advanced analytical techniques<\/td><\/tr><\/tbody><\/table><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>iii. Programming Languages and Tools: Data Analyst vs. Data Scientist\u00a0<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Programming languages and tools play a key role in helping data professionals collect, analyze, and interpret data. While both roles use SQL and Python, the tools and technologies they rely on differ based on the complexity of their work.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The table below compares the commonly used programming languages and tools for both roles.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-table\"><table><tbody><tr><td><strong>Aspect<\/strong><\/td><td><strong>Data Analyst<\/strong><\/td><td><strong>Data Scientist<\/strong><\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Programming Languages<\/strong><\/td><td>SQL, Python, R<\/td><td>Python, R, SQL, Java, Scala<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Database Tools<\/strong><\/td><td><a href=\"https:\/\/trainings.internshala.com\/blog\/what-is-mysql\/?utm_source=is_blog&amp;utm_medium=data-analyst-vs-data-scientist-complete-guide&amp;utm_campaign=candidate-blog-detail\">MySQL<\/a>, PostgreSQL, Microsoft SQL Server<\/td><td>MySQL, <a href=\"https:\/\/trainings.internshala.com\/blog\/what-is-postgresql\/?utm_source=is_blog&amp;utm_medium=data-analyst-vs-data-scientist-complete-guide&amp;utm_campaign=candidate-blog-detail\">PostgreSQL<\/a>, MongoDB, Cassandra<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Data Visualization Tools<\/strong><\/td><td>Power BI, Tableau, Looker Studio, Microsoft Excel<\/td><td>Tableau, Power BI, Matplotlib, Plotly, Seaborn<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Data Analysis Libraries<\/strong><\/td><td>Pandas, NumPy<\/td><td>Pandas, NumPy, SciPy<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Machine Learning Frameworks<\/strong><\/td><td>Basic use of Scikit-learn (optional)<\/td><td>Scikit-learn, TensorFlow, PyTorch, XGBoost<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Big Data Technologies<\/strong><\/td><td>Basic knowledge of Hadoop and Spark (optional)<\/td><td>Hadoop, Apache Spark, Hive, Kafka<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Cloud Platforms<\/strong><\/td><td>Microsoft Azure, AWS, Google Cloud (basic knowledge)<\/td><td>AWS, Microsoft Azure, Google Cloud (hands-on experience)<\/td><\/tr><tr><td><strong>Development Tools<\/strong><\/td><td>Jupyter Notebook, Microsoft Excel, Power BI<\/td><td>Jupyter Notebook, Google Colab, VS Code, PyCharm<\/td><\/tr><\/tbody><\/table><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>iv. If you enjoy analyzing historical data, creating reports, and supporting business decisions, a data analyst role may be the better fit. If you prefer programming, machine learning, and building predictive models to solve complex problems, a career as a data scientist is more suitable.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>When comparing data analyst vs. data scientist, data analyst roles are generally more accessible for beginners, while data scientist roles require stronger expertise in programming, statistics, and artificial intelligence. Evaluate your strengths, learning preferences, and long-term career aspirations to choose the path that best aligns with your goals.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large desktop-image\"><a href=\"https:\/\/internshala.com\/?utm_source=is_blog&amp;utm_medium=data-analyst-vs-data-scientist-complete-guide&amp;utm_campaign=candidate-web-banner\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"203\" src=\"https:\/\/internshala.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/10\/Find-and-apply-web-1024x203.jpg\" alt=\"Find and apply web banner\" class=\"wp-image-25333\" srcset=\"https:\/\/internshala.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/10\/Find-and-apply-web-1024x203.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/internshala.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/10\/Find-and-apply-web-672x133.jpg 672w, https:\/\/internshala.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/10\/Find-and-apply-web-1536x305.jpg 1536w, https:\/\/internshala.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/10\/Find-and-apply-web-2048x406.jpg 2048w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><\/a><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-full mobile-image\"><a href=\"https:\/\/internshala.com\/?utm_source=is_blog&amp;utm_medium=data-analyst-vs-data-scientist-complete-guide&amp;utm_campaign=candidate-mobile-banner\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"356\" height=\"256\" src=\"https:\/\/internshala.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/10\/Find-and-apply-mobile-1.jpg\" alt=\"Find and apply mobile banner\" class=\"wp-image-25334\"\/><\/a><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Conclusion\"><\/span><strong>Conclusion<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>In this data analyst vs. data scientist blog, we explored the key differences between these two high-demand careers. Can a data analyst become a data scientist?<\/strong><\/strong><\/strong> <p class=\"schema-faq-answer\"><strong>Answer:<\/strong> Yes. Many professionals begin their careers as data analysts and later transition to data science by learning Python, machine learning, statistics, and artificial intelligence. Earning relevant certifications and gaining hands-on project experience can help make this transition easier.<\/p> <\/div> <div class=\"schema-faq-section\" id=\"faq-question-1785317515124\"><strong class=\"schema-faq-question\">Q<strong>3. Is coding required for both data analysts and data scientists?<\/strong><\/strong> <p class=\"schema-faq-answer\"><strong>Answer: <\/strong>Yes, but the level of coding differs. Data analysts typically use SQL and basic Python or R for data analysis and reporting. Data scientists require advanced programming skills in Python, R, SQL, and other languages to build machine learning models and work with large datasets.<\/p> <\/div> <\/div>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Sources<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<ul>\n<li>https:\/\/www.ibef.org\/research\/case-study\/future-of-data-science-and-ai-in-india<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<aside class=\"mashsb-container mashsb-main \"><div class=\"mashsb-box\"><div class=\"mashsb-count mash-medium\" style=\"float:left\"><div class=\"counts mashsbcount\">0<\/div><span class=\"mashsb-sharetext\">SHARES<\/span><\/div><div class=\"mashsb-buttons\"><a class=\"mashicon-facebook mash-medium mashsb-noshadow\" href=\"https:\/\/www.facebook.com\/sharer.php?u=https%3A%2F%2Finternshala.com%2Fblog%2Fdata-analyst-vs-data-scientist-complete-guide%2F\" target=\"_top\" rel=\"nofollow\"><span class=\"icon\"><\/span><span class=\"text\">Share&nbsp;on&nbsp;Facebook<\/span><\/a><a class=\"mashicon-subscribe mash-medium mashsb-noshadow\" href=\"#\" target=\"_top\" rel=\"nofollow\"><span class=\"icon\"><\/span><span class=\"text\">Get&nbsp;Your&nbsp;Dream&nbsp;Internship<\/span><\/a><div class=\"onoffswitch2 mash-medium mashsb-noshadow\" style=\"display:none\"><\/div><\/div>\n            <\/div>\n                <div style=\"clear:both\"><\/div><\/aside>\n            <!-- Share buttons by mashshare.net - Version: 4.0.42-->","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Summary: Data analysts and data scientists are professionals who help organizations make informed business decisions by collecting, analyzing, and interpreting data.
